When it comes to home improvement and renovations, painting concrete surfaces can vastly improve the aesthetics and longevity of your structures. Concrete paints are specially formulated to adhere to the porous and rough texture of concrete, providing a protective layer against moisture, chemicals, and general wear and tear. Whether you’re looking to upgrade your garage floor, patio, or basement walls, choosing the right concrete paint is crucial to ensure durability and longevity.
Common Misconceptions About Concrete Paints
Many people believe that any paint can be used on concrete surfaces, but this is a significant misconception. Regular paints may peel, chip, or fade quickly when applied to concrete due to its unique properties. Another common myth is that concrete paints are all the same, but in reality, there are numerous types tailored for specific uses, such as epoxy-based, acrylic, or latex concrete paints. Understanding these differences can lead to more effective and lasting results.
The Importance of Choosing the Right Paint
Selecting the appropriate concrete paint isn’t just about color preference or finish; it’s about long-term performance. The right paint can prevent damage from moisture intrusion, resist wear and tear, and even hide imperfections in the concrete. Investing in a high-quality concrete paint can save you money in the long run by reducing the frequency of repaints and repairs, protecting the structural integrity of your surfaces.
Key Factors to Consider When Selecting Concrete Paint
Several key factors should be considered when selecting concrete paint. These include the specific area of application (indoor vs. outdoor), the level of foot or vehicular traffic, exposure to elements like sunlight and moisture, and the type of finish desired (matte, glossy, textured). Additionally, considering the ease of application and drying time can make your project more manageable and efficient.
